Re: [EGD-discu] Bépo dans Android

[ Thread Index | Date Index | More ergodis.org/discussions Archives ]


Bon, moi je suis un peu dégoutté parce que j'ai découvert la présence du bépo dans une version test d'AICP et maintenant que je suis revenu à la version nightly, il n'y est plus, donc je ne peux pas jouer avec, il faut que j'écrives aux devs pour le leur demander.
En tous cas, merci à Julien pour son initiative et pour venir partager ça avec nous.

NémOlivier.

Le mer. 21 oct. 2015 à 14:31, Julien RIVAUD (_FrnchFrgg_) <frnchfrgg@xxxxxxx> a écrit :
Le 20/10/2015 17:39, Brosseau Valentin a écrit :
> Je suis intéressé effectivement.

Voilà.

https://gitlab.com/frnchfrgg/small-hacks/raw/master/android-bepo-patchIME.zip

Je suis sous Linux donc c'est un script bash, à adapter pour les Windows
(normalement sous Mac ça ressemble beaucoup). Pour le lancer,
décompresser tout dans un dossier puis lancer dans un terminal

bash do_patch

dans le dossier en question.

Il est indispensable d'avoir les droits pour modifier la partition
système, donc sur une ROM Samsung ou LG non rootée ça ne fonctionnera pas.

Attention, il y a peut-être des choses à ajuster selon la ROM Android
utilisée. Notamment, les clés de signature que j'utilise viennent de
CyanogenMod, il est possible qu'une autre ROM ne les accepte pas auquel
cas il faut remplacer les platform.* par celles qui conviennent. Ce
n'est pas dit que les clefs de Samsung ou LG ou autre soient librement
disponibles. Peut-être que l'emplacement de LatinIME.apk peut changer,
dans ce cas ça plantera dès le début. À ajuster.

Après avoir lancé le script avec succès, il faut redémarrer le téléphone
(avec adb reboot par exemple). Je ne l'ai pas mis dans le script pour
avoir le temps de vérifier les résultats avant. Si lors du reboot le
clavier ne marche plus, c'est qu'un truc a râté et il faut restaurer le
LatinIME.apk d'origine avec

adb root
adb remount
adb push /path/to/work/orig/LatinIME.apk /system/app/LatinIME/LatinIME.apk
adb reboot

pour récupérer un clavier fonctionnel.

Julien "_FrnchFrgg_" RIVAUD

--
Pour ne plus recevoir les messels de cette liste de discussion, envoyez un messel avec pour destinataire discussions-REQUEST@xxxxxxxxxxx et pour sujet "unsubscribe".



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/